Château Belgrave

Château Belgrave wines are a captivating expression of Bordeaux's rich terroir, showcasing a harmonious blend of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, and other varietals. Aromas of ripe blackcurrant and plum waft elegantly, intertwining with hints of earth and cedar. On the palate, a velvety texture unfolds, delivering layers of dark fruit, spice, and a subtle minerality. With a tradition rooted in meticulous craftsmanship, these wines exude refinement and balance, making them a truly remarkable representation of the region’s storied heritage.

Grape

Carménère

In the sun-drenched valleys of Chile, where the Andes cradle vineyards in their verdant embrace, the Carménère grape ripens, cloaked in deep purple. Its wine spills forth with aromas of blackberry and a hint of green bell pepper, evoking the crispness of summer mornings. Rich and velvety on the palate, it unfurls layers of dark fruit mingled with a whisper of baking spice. Can a single sip truly encapsulate centuries of resilience and rediscovery?
